One step in the graduation process is to move the SVN repository.
There is also JENA-191 which is to re-organise the structure.
Combining the two seems to me to be a good idea - just one step of major
change.
Proposal:
Move the tree exactly as is (I suspect we need infra to make that change
because of security)
Then "immediately" make these changes which move the main modules into a
single trunk arrangement.
/Jena2/IRI/trunk -> /trunk/jena-iri
/Jena2/ARQ/trunk -> /trunk/jena-arq
/Jena2/jena/trunk -> /trunk/jena-core
/Jena2/TDB/trunk -> /trunk/jena-tdb
/Jena2/Fuseki/trunk -> /trunk/jena-fuseki
/Jena2/SDB/trunk -> /trunk/jena-sdb
/Jena2/LARQ/trunk -> /trunk/jena-larq
/Jena2/JenaTop/trunk -> /trunk/jena-top ?? jena-parent
/Jena2/Examples/trunk -> /trunk/jena-examples
This is minimal - further changes may be needed.
Initially the build will be as now, we can then change it because we now
have the right layout. We then have a one-step build.
(Paolo has experimented with a multiple module build in jena-dist)
If I hear nothing in 3 days (or a bit more :-), I'll start this process.
